The Thomas Ellis Memorial Fund

The fund was raised by public subscription and was transferred to the University of Wales as Trustee to perpetuate the memory of the late Thomas Edward Ellis MA, Warden of the Guild of Graduates (1896-1899), and a Member of Parliament representing Merioneth during the years 1886-1899. The T Alwyn Lloyd Memorial Travelling Scholarship

This fund consists of an annual income of about £3,000 derived from a bequest made to the University of Wales by the late Thomas Alwyn Lloyd LLD FRIBA. The Sir Samuel Evans Prize

The Prize is provided from the income of a Fund raised by public subscription to perpetuate the memory of the late Right Honourable Sir Samuel Thomas Evans PC GCB LLD (1859-1919), and transferred to the University of Wales to be administered under a deed of trust dated 2 February, 1923. Rosa Hovey Memorial Scholarship

This Scholarship is provided from the income of gifts made to the University of Wales in October 1934, and January 1949, by the late Miss Ethel M Hovey, of Colwyn Bay. The John Maclean Prize

The Prize was endowed in December 1923, by Professor Sir Ewen J Maclean MD, in memory of his father, the late John Maclean of Kilmoluag, Tiree, and of Mount Hill, Carmarthen.
